Palo Duro Canyon State Park Canyon, TX

Texas
Location: South of Amarillo off I-27. At the end of TX 217 about 8 miles east of I-27 (12 miles east of Canyon).
GPS Coordinates: 34.97534N, 101.6759W
Our Site Number: Mesquite Campground #89
Reason Selected:Howard & Linda (RV-Dreams) had ranked 8
Price & Discounts: $28 a night PLUS a $4 park entry fee per day per person which amounted to $34 per night
Rank: 8 (out of ten)
Setting: Three campgrounds on the floor of a deep canyon. Each campground is slightly different, but mostly the sites are open and tucked in between mesquite trees and junipers. Good views of the canyon walls from all sites. The campground roads are paved, but the pads are gravel. Other than a couple power lines, nothing to impair the sight lines and only the noise of the wind, birds, and park traffic can be heard.
Big Rig Friendly: There is a windy one-mile 10% grade driving down into the canyon. Caution is required for big rigs around the sharp turns. But with patience and remaining in the lowest gear going down, there should be no problem. The Sagebrush Campground is big rig friendly and closer to the entrance of the park. The Hackberry Campground is for smaller rigs. The Mesquite Campground is at the end of the park road and has good views, but you have to make several low crossings that can be flooded at times. When dry, there shouldn’t be an issue, but you might drag going through the crossings if you are very long. Still, there are plenty of larger rigs found in the campgrounds.
Hook-ups: Water and 50/30 amp electric in Sagebrush & Mesquite Campgrounds. Water and 30 amp electric in Hackberry. Each campground has a bathhouse with flush toilets and showers. And each campground has a dump station.
Laundry: None.
Other Factors: Rooftop satellite is no problem in the two larger campgrounds. The bathhouse was clean, but a little smelly. Our cell phones work just fine with our amplifier.
OVERALL RATING: 8 (out of ten)
